1. Make sure your computer's applications, mic, and webcam are working properly before the meeting.


Create a test call to a friend or relative an hour or so before the interview and familiarize yourself with video calling. Make sure you give yourself sufficient time to repair any problems that might come up. Check your online connection to try and avoid any connectivity issues during the call.


2. Prepare your environment


Employers will not only find you, but your surroundings. Make sure the area behind you're clean, neat, and not distracting. Go somewhere quiet and be certain to turn your cell phone ringer off. Make sure the lighting is good and the interviewer can see you clearly.


3. Dress Nicely


Even though you won't be visiting that the interviewer in person, it's necessary to still dress well, as though you were going to this job interview in person. visit the site , technology, and environmental businesses can be quite a competitive job market, the interview has to be taken very seriously, although it is not exactly what you're utilized to.


4. Familiarize Yourself With The Company


Find out about the company you're interviewing for. You may stand out as a interviewee when you have taken the opportunity to get to know the organization and can be sure you are the employee they are looking for.


Last and most important, don't be late or miss out the video call! This is the exact same as being late or missing an in-person job interview.
